Homeward Selected to Receive Award for up to $12 Million from ARPA-H’s PARADIGM Program

SAN FRANCISCO–(BUSINESS WIRE)–Homeward®, a company committed to rearchitecting the delivery of health and care in partnership with communities everywhere, starting in rural America, today announced it has been awarded up to $12 million in research funding to serve as a lead performer for The Advanced Research Projects Agency for Health (ARPA-H) Platform Accelerating Rural Access to Distributed and InteGrated Medical Care (PARADIGM) program. The program is a 5-year project to develop a scalable mobile platform that can bring sophisticated medical services – including perinatal care, advanced wound care, and more – outside of a hospital setting to the doorstep of even the most remote, rural populations.

“Rural America faces some of the greatest healthcare challenges in our country, with higher mortality rates and limited access to essential care due to a shortage of hospitals, specialty clinics, and healthcare workers,” said Homeward Co-Founder and President Amar Kendale. “At Homeward, our mission is to rearchitect the delivery of health and care in partnership with communities in rural America, and the PARADIGM program is a critical step in advancing this mission. With the rapid rise of artificial intelligence and other health technologies, we have an opportunity to bring advanced medical services and specialty care directly to those who need it most – with the potential to leapfrog other markets – ensuring no community is left behind.”

PARADIGM is funding part of Homeward’s Advanced Research Program, a cornerstone effort to advance healthcare solutions for rural communities where access is limited. As AI and health technology continue to evolve, rural healthcare providers often face significant barriers to adoption due to lack of solutions designed for their unique needs. Homeward’s new research and development initiative will bring technology that is specifically adapted to the needs of rural communities so that it will make a real difference in peoples’ lives, in partnership with rural providers, academic centers and other community stakeholders. Research and development projects led through Homeward’s Advanced Research Program are designed to make health technology more accessible, equitable and impactful for the millions of Americans living in rural areas.

“Solving the rural healthcare crisis requires new approaches and ideas designed with rural communities in mind, which is the driving force behind Homeward’s Advanced Research Program,” said Vice President of Advanced Research Programs at Homeward Fred Barrigar. “Through initiatives like PARADIGM, we’re developing and testing solutions with partners in rural communities where traditional healthcare models fall short. From improving how treatments are delivered to advancing diagnostic tools, our goal is to create scalable innovations that improve care delivery and accessibility in rural communities.”

The PARADIGM program anchors this initiative by addressing all three of the Advanced Research Program’s focus areas: workforce transformation, advanced therapeutic delivery, and distributed diagnostics. The project will focus on defining clinical services, collaborating with technology partners to develop and implement solutions, and conducting clinical research studies with subcontractor grant organizations, including the University of Minnesota and Mobile Health Map (MHM) at Harvard Medical School.

MHM is a national collaborative that helps mobile clinics measure, improve, and communicate their impact. MHM will focus on ensuring the PARADIGM care delivery model reflects the real-world needs of rural communities. The University of Minnesota will serve as a co-principal investigator, leading efforts to evaluate the PARADIGM program’s clinical effectiveness and effect on reducing healthcare disparities.

“The University of Minnesota is proud to partner with Homeward and advance the PARADIGM program to understand how we might best deliver care to rural communities in Minnesota,” said Associate Professor of Medicine at the University of Minnesota and faculty in the Program for Health Disparities Research Dr. Elizabeth Rogers, who is leading the evaluation of this project. “Research is critical to understanding what works and its impact so we can improve care delivery in meaningful ways. By turning insights into thoughtful programs, we aim to eliminate the healthcare disparities that rural communities have faced for far too long.”

Kimberly-Clark Corporation, one of the world's leading manufacturers of personal care and hygiene products, will establish an $800 million advanced manufacturing facility in Trumbull County, bringing an anticipated 491 new high-quality jobs. For Kimberly-Clark, this new facility would be its first in Ohio and represents not just a strategic expansion, but a decisive step in doubling down on growth in the American market. Spread across more than one million square feet, the Warren facility will provide the manufacturing capacity needed to unleash future growth for Kimberly-Clark’s fastest-growing personal care categories that include Baby & Child Care and Adult & Feminine Care. Warren is in geographic proximity to roughly 117 million consumers and will serve as a strategic hub for the Northeast and Midwest regions. Construction is expected to begin this month and will take up to two years.

In a statement Tamera Fenske, chief supply chain officer at Kimberly-Clark said, “Our investment in Warren is a pivotal step forward in our North America business and strategy.” “By establishing a new, state-of-the-art manufacturing facility in Ohio, we’re enhancing our ability to serve millions of consumers across the Midwest and Northeast with greater speed, agility, and resilience. It’s a once-in-a-career opportunity to build a facility from the ground up that reflects the future of manufacturing, and with the support of local partners like JobsOhio, the Department of Development, Lake to River, Western Reserve Port Authority, and local governments, we have the unique opportunity to create high-quality jobs and long-term economic impact in the region.”

Based in Dallas and employing 46,000 people in 34 countries, the company’s portfolio of brands also includes Huggies, Kleenex, Scott, Kotex, Cottonelle, Poise, Depend, Andrex, Pull-Ups, GoodNites, Intimus, Plenitud, Sweety, Softex, Viva and WypAll. Its products are sold in more than 175 countries and territories.

Snorkel AI announced general availability of two new product offerings on the Snorkel AI Data Development Platform: Snorkel Evaluate and Snorkel Expert Data-as-a-Service. These launches advance its mission to turn knowledge into specialized AI—helping teams move from prototype to production at scale by leveraging Snorkel AI’s programmatic data development technology. In addition, Snorkel AI announced it has raised $100 million in Series D funding at a $1.3 billion valuation, led by Addition. This new funding will fuel continued research and innovation in evaluating and tuning specialized AI systems with expert data.


In a statement Alex Ratner, Co-founder and CEO of Snorkel AI said, “We are seeing a surge of momentum around agentic AI, but specialized enterprise agents aren’t ready for production in most settings.” “Enterprises need domain-specific data and expertise to make this a reality. We’re excited to deliver on this need and help AI innovators develop expert data to bring their LLM and agentic systems into production with our new offerings, which round out Snorkel’s unified AI data development stack.”

Snorkel AI is building the Snorkel AI Data Development Platform for evaluating and tuning specialized AI at scale. Snorkel AI’s offerings, including Snorkel Evaluate and Snorkel Expert Data-as-a-Service, accelerate evaluation and tuning of specialized AI systems with expert data—helping teams move from prototype to production at scale by leveraging Snorkel AI’s programmatic data development technology. Launched out of the Stanford AI Lab, Snorkel AI’s platform is used in production by Fortune 500 companies, including BNY, Wayfair, and Chubb, as well as across the U.S. federal government, including the U.S. Air Force.

TicketManager, a global leader in event ticket and guest management solutions for the corporate enterprise, today announced Valeas Capital Partners, a growth-oriented private-equity firm, has acquired a majority stake in the company. Under the terms of the agreement, Valeas is committing $110 million to support TicketManager’s strategic growth plans. TicketManager Co-Founder and CEO Tony Knopp and COO Ken Hanscom will retain a minority interest in the Company. Founded in 2007, TicketManager is the category leader in providing software and services to manage end-to-end event ticket workflow and guest experiences. Serving as the central hub and system of record for data-driven organizations, the platform streamlines every step of the ticket management process. Every year, companies spend more than $600 billion on customer entertainment, yet 43% of corporate tickets are never used and fewer than 20% of organizations leverage modern software to optimize those investments and mitigate compliance risk.

In a statement Tony Knopp, CEO and Co-Founder of TicketManager said, “Live events are an important investment for businesses of all sizes. Whether major global sponsorships, naming rights for stadiums, luxury suites or even a few season tickets for the local team, companies use them to attract and keep customers while building their brands. But in today’s market, many companies struggle with growing pressure to show the value of their ticket spending.” “We knew there was a better way, and that’s why we created TicketManager – to make company tickets easy and prove the return on investment with cutting edge technology and services.”

TicketManager is a leading event- and guest-management platform that empowers companies to make client entertainment easy and drive greater return on investment. It offers convenient and simple technology to manage corporate sports and entertainment tickets, create exceptional guest life-cycle experiences, and measure effectiveness. TicketManager is trusted by more than 500 global brands including Verizon, FedEx, Adidas, Anheuser-Busch, and Mastercard.
